Installation Guide:
Download and extract the NoPixel 4.0 Inventory Script.
Move the folder into your resources/[inventory]/ directory.
Add ensure nopixel_inventory to your server.cfg.
Configure the script via config.lua for item settings and UI preferences.
Restart your server and enjoy your modern inventory system.
